Jim Kee
Profile
Dr. James R.
Kee is a President, Chief Economist & Partner at South Texas Money Management Ltd.
He joined South Texas Money Management at the beginning of 2009 and serves as the Chief Economist.
He was named President of the firm in April 2011.
His expertise lies in combining top-down, macroeconomic insights with bottom-up stock selection tools.
He works with both the investment research group and the investment advisors at STMM.
Prior to joining STMM, Dr. Kee was the HOLT global strategist for Credit Suisse in Chicago.
At Credit Suisse, he produced timely investment advice for external clients and for internal investment and marketing teams.
He also served as a portfolio consultant with HOLT Value Associates prior to their acquisition by Credit Suisse in 2002.
As a portfolio consultant, he worked with clients to identify strengths and weaknesses of equity holdings and to suggest alternative stocks and allocations.
Dr. Kee has a Ph.D.
in Economics from Auburn University, a Master’s degree in Economics from St. Mary’s University of San Antonio (Distinguished Graduate), and a B.A.
in Economics from St. Edwards University (Austin).
